 +===== Post-Processing of RT Oscillation Data =====
 +
 +  * idea: : resonant frequency ω0 and decay time constant λ, are fixed by hardware
 +  * omission of inexact peak detector
 +  <color #ed1c24>-> improved RT resolution by digitization of oscillation data, FFT filtering and envelope fit </color>  
 +
 +==== Algorithm for bunch charge determination ====
  
 +  * FFT filtering and offset correction
 +  * identification of maxima and minima until preset S/N value crossed
 +  * robust estimator of exponential decay curve 
 +  * evaluation of amplitude ~ total pulse charge
